1. Defining the Trimless Aesthetic: Why “Less” is Truly “More”
In the traditional world of signage, channel letters have always been built with a “trim cap.” The trim cap is essentially a plastic rim that frames the front face of the letter and attaches it to the metal sides, or returns. While this method has served the industry for decades, it comes with a set of visual and structural limitations. The trim cap creates a visible border that can break up the lines of a logo and make a sign look “framed” or heavy. In contrast, trimless channel letters are manufactured without this visible plastic cap. This creates a seamless transition from the letter face to the return, resulting in a minimalist and clean-cut approach that heightens visual appeal through sheer simplicity.
The difference might seem subtle at first glance, but the impact on overall branding is significant. Trimless letters offer a more sophisticated appearance, elevating the visual appeal of a storefront to match modern architectural trends. This choice allows for greater creative freedom, as designers are no longer restricted by the limited colors and widths of traditional trim caps. Instead, the focus is entirely on the customized lettering or logo, allowing for a bolder statement that resonates with customers on a deeper level. Whether it’s a high-end retail boutique or a tech startup’s corporate lobby, the trimless look conveys a sense of elegance and attention to detail that is hard to replicate with traditional methods.
“Trimless channel letters have revolutionized the world of illuminated signage by offering a sleek and modern alternative that pushes boundaries and redefines what is possible in LED displays.”
Furthermore, the absence of a visible border allows the LED light inside the letter to reach the absolute edge of the face. In a trimmed letter, the plastic cap often blocks a small portion of the light at the rim, creating a slight “shadow” or framed effect. In a trimless letter, the illumination is edge-to-edge. This makes the letters appear crisper and more legible from a distance, especially during the night when visibility is most crucial. For businesses located in crowded marketplaces or on busy city streets, this extra bit of visibility can be the difference between being noticed and being overlooked.

2. Anatomy of Excellence: The Components of a Trimless Sign
To truly appreciate how a trimless channel letter functions, we must examine its internal and external components. Because there is no trim cap to hide imperfections or gaps, each piece of the letter must be manufactured to much tighter tolerances than a standard sign. The engineering of a trimless letter is a balance of structural integrity and visual purity. Each component plays a vital role in ensuring the sign remains stable, weather-resistant, and brilliantly lit for years to come.
The Acrylic Face: The Canvas of the Sign
The face is the front and center of the letter—the part that displays the color and the brand’s identity. In trimless letters, the face is typically crafted from high-grade acrylic sheets. These can be clear, translucent, or opaque depending on the desired lighting effect. Because there is no border, the acrylic must be cut with surgical precision. Most modern fabricators use CNC routers or laser acrylic cutting machines to ensure that the face matches the design specifications down to the millimeter. This precision is what allows the face to sit perfectly flush against the metal returns.
The Returns: The Structural Backbone
The “returns” are the sidewalls that give the letters their three-dimensional depth. In the world of trimless signage, these are almost exclusively made from durable metals like aluminum. Aluminum is favored because it is lightweight, rust-proof, and can be easily shaped by automated machines. The returns are the most critical part of the structure, as they must be bent into perfect curves or sharp angles to follow the exact path of the acrylic face. When the returns are formed correctly, they provide the rigid framework that supports the entire letter.
The Back: Stability from the Rear
The back of each letter closes the structure and provides the mounting surface for the internal electronics. Like the returns, the back is often made from aluminum, which offers a strong and weather-resistant solution. These backings help to reinforce the structure and serve as a heat sink for the LED modules. In many trimless designs, the back is secured tightly to the returns using advanced fastening techniques like self-piercing rivets or press-forming, which eliminates the need for unsightly screws or bolts on the visible surfaces of the sign.
The Illumination: High-Efficiency LED Modules
A sign is only as good as its light. Modern trimless letters utilize energy-efficient LED lighting. LEDs are chosen because they consume significantly less power than traditional neon or fluorescent lights, and they last much longer—often up to 50,000 hours or more. Because the internal space of a channel letter can be tight, small LED modules are used to provide an even, bright glow. Companies like GOQ LED America provide modules that are weather-protected and durable, ensuring that the sign remains bright and beautiful through rain, snow, and heat.

3. The Art of the Build: How Trimless Channel Letters Are Made
The creation of a trimless channel letter is a multi-step process that combines digital precision with high-tech craftsmanship. Unlike traditional sign making, which often relied on manual labor and “eye-balling” measurements, trimless fabrication is a science of automation. Every step in the workflow is designed to minimize human error and ensure a tight, seamless assembly that meets the highest standards of aesthetics and quality. Let’s walk through the four-step workflow that has been refined over decades by industry pioneers like Computerized Cutters.
Step 1: Digital Design and Machine Planning
The journey begins on a computer. A graphic designer takes the client’s logo or typography and converts it into a vector format that the fabrication machines can read. This isn’t just a simple drawing; it includes the precise paths for cutting and the exact points where the metal should be notched or bent. Because trimless letters have no “border” to hide imperfections, the tolerance levels in the design phase are extremely tight. The software must account for the thickness of the acrylic and the metal coil to ensure a perfect fit later in the assembly.
Step 2: Precision Bending of the Returns
The creation of the side walls, or returns, is handled by an automated channel letter bender, such as the Accu-Bend machine. The machine feeds standard aluminum coils—ranging from 0.032” to 0.063” in thickness—and uses a series of bending arms and notching mechanisms to form the three-dimensional shape of the letter. These machines are capable of producing highly complex shapes with repeatable accuracy. By accurately notching and flanging the metal, the machine ensures that the return will perfectly fit the letter face without any gaps. This automation relieves the sign shop of labor-intensive tasks while delivering a superior level of structural integrity.
Step 3: High-Accuracy Cutting of the Face
While the returns are being bent, a CNC router table like the Accu-Cut XLR8 is used to produce the acrylic faces. In a trimless design, the face must fit directly into the internal dimensions of the metal return. The Accu-Cut XLR8 is engineered to deliver a cutting accuracy of approximately ±0.003 inches. This precision is what allows the face to be “snap-fitted” into the returns. If the face were even a fraction of an inch too large or too small, the trimless effect would be ruined by light leaks or visible gaps. The combined capabilities of the bending and cutting machines allow even the most intricate script designs to be produced flawlessly.
Step 4: Advanced Assembly and Bonding
Once the components are cut and bent, they must be joined. In trimless letters, this is often done using high-strength adhesives or specialized screws. Some manufacturers use handheld laser welders to fuse the returns and face together, creating a permanent bond that maintains the sleek look. Following the face attachment, the internal LED lighting is installed. The final step is adding the aluminum back plate, which is often secured using a press-form method (like the Accu-Clinch) or self-piercing rivets. This four-step workflow results in a finished channel letter that is ready for use within minutes, showcasing decades of automated production mastery.

4. A Legacy of Pioneering Automation: 25 Years of Mastery
The shift toward trimless channel letters is not just a passing trend; it is the culmination of over two decades of technological evolution. In 1997, the sign industry was transformed by the introduction of the first computerized channel letter bending machine. Since then, manufacturers like Computerized Cutters have pushed the boundaries of what is possible, moving from manually crafted metal returns to a highly automated process. This history of innovation has provided sign shops with the tools needed to move toward one-piece, seamless designs that meet the modern market’s demand for quality and efficiency.
The Accu-Bend technology, for instance, has evolved from basic bending to a sophisticated system featuring dual-bending arms and advanced notching mechanisms. These machines are not just about speed; they are about consistency. In a sign with dozens of letters, every single ‘E’ must look identical to every other ‘E’. Automation ensures that the metal returns are repeatable and precise, providing the perfect foundation for a trimless fit. By leveraging these machines, sign fabricators can reduce production time dramatically while significantly lowering material costs by eliminating the need for expensive plastic trim cap components.

5. The Practical Advantages: Durability, Maintenance, and Long-Term Value
While the aesthetic appeal of trimless channel letters is undeniable, the practical benefits are equally compelling. Many business owners are initially drawn to the look of a seamless sign, but they choose to invest because of the durability and ease of upkeep. Traditional trim cap letters come with several inherent challenges that can lead to higher costs over the life of the sign. These include the difficulty of painting a trim cap a custom color, the risk of water being funneled down inside the letter face, and the overall shorter longevity of plastic components in harsh outdoor environments.
Eliminating the Failure Points of Plastic Trim
In traditional signs, the trim cap is often the first part to fail. Because it is made of plastic, it is susceptible to UV degradation from the sun, which causes it to become brittle, crack, or fade over time. When a trim cap cracks, it allows moisture to enter the letter, which can short-circuit the LEDs or lead to rust on the internal backing. Trimless channel letters, by removing the trim cap entirely, eliminate this primary failure point. The seamless joint between the metal and acrylic is much more resistant to weather and wear, leading to a sign that looks brand new for a much longer period.
Simplified Cleaning and Maintenance
Maintenance is another area where trimless letters shine. Their streamlined design features modular components that can be easily repaired or replaced without specialized tools. For example, many trimless signs use screw-mounted removable faces. If an LED needs to be serviced after many years of use, the face can be removed for servicing without having to disassemble the entire sign. Furthermore, the minimalistic design reduces the risk of dust buildup, water spots, and debris that can affect the appearance and functionality of traditional signage. This makes them not only easier to clean but also less prone to long-term damage.
Improved Energy Efficiency and Environmental Impact
Thanks to the standard use of LED lighting, trimless channel letters are an eco-friendly choice for modern businesses. LEDs use less energy, emit less heat, and last longer than any other lighting technology. When combined with the high durability of the metal-and-acrylic trimless structure, these signs have a much lower total environmental footprint. They require fewer replacements and use less power over their lifetime, making them a sustainable choice that appeals to environmentally conscious consumers and reduces the business’s carbon footprint.

6. Strategic Selection: When and When Not to Use Trimless
Choosing the right signage for your business depends on a few key factors, including your brand’s personality, your budget, and the physical location of the sign. While trimless letters offer many advantages, they are a specialized product that is best suited for certain environments. Understanding when to use them—and when a traditional sign might actually be better—will help you deliver the best value for your investment.
Ideal Applications for Trimless Signage
Trimless channel letters are particularly effective for “architectural” signage—those signs that are viewed up close or from multiple angles. This includes indoor spaces, high-end retail storefronts, malls, and monument signs. Because these signs are often seen from just a few feet away, the clean lines and absence of bulky trim are very apparent and add a layer of prestige to the business. They are also the perfect choice for signs with sharp points or fine script details that a traditional trim cap might obscure or round off. If your brand is sleek, modern, and high-tech, trimless is the logical fit.
When Traditional Trim Cap May Be Preferable
There are some cases where trimless letters might not be the best choice. For extremely large channel letters—those greater than 48 inches tall—traditional methods are often more practical. Large signs placed high on top of buildings require extra structural support, such as metal retainers, to handle extreme wind loads. At that distance, the visual benefit of being “trimless” is lost on the viewer, and the extra cost of trimless fabrication isn’t always justified. Additionally, if a client is prioritizing the absolute cheapest and fastest option, traditional trimmed letters remain the industry’s “quick and easy” solution. Finally, some branding guidelines may specifically require a trim cap border to maintain a consistent look across a national franchise.
Three Categories of Trimless Fabrication
If you decide to go trimless, you should be aware that there are three main categories of fabrication most often requested:
- Screw-Mounted Removable Acrylic Faces: This approach allows the faces to be removed for easy maintenance of the LEDs. It is the most popular choice for retail and commercial signage.
- Adhesive-Sealed Faces with Removable Backs: This creates a permanently sealed front for maximum weather resistance, with all servicing done through the rear of the letter.
- Specialty Methods: This includes high-end options like acrylic blocks, 3D-printed letters, or resin-poured faces, used for unique architectural designs that require a solid, crystal-like glow.

Frequently Asked Questions (FAQ)
1. What materials are used to make trimless channel letters?
Trimless channel letters are primarily constructed from three core materials: high-grade acrylic for the face, aluminum for the returns and backing plates, and energy-efficient LED modules for internal illumination. These materials are chosen for their durability, light weight, and resistance to outdoor weather conditions.
2. Are trimless channel letters more expensive than traditional signs?
Yes, the upfront cost of trimless signage is typically higher than traditional trim cap letters. This is because trimless fabrication requires higher-precision machinery (like CNC routers with ±0.003″ accuracy) and specialized assembly labor. However, because they are more durable and easier to maintain, they often have a lower total cost of ownership over several years.
3. Can I use trimless channel letters for an outdoor storefront?
Absolutely! Trimless channel letters are designed to be weather-resistant and are a perfect choice for outdoor signage. Their seamless construction actually reduces the risk of water intrusion and environmental damage compared to traditional signs that use plastic trim bands.
4. How long do trimless channel letters last compared to trimmed signs?
With proper maintenance and high-quality LEDs, a trimless sign can last 10 years or more. Because they eliminate the plastic trim cap—the part most likely to fail due to sun and temperature changes—they typically maintain their “like-new” appearance much longer than traditional signs.
5. What is the “sweet spot” size for a trimless sign?
The ideal size for trimless letters is between 6 inches and 28 inches tall. In this range, the detail and clean aesthetic are most noticeable to customers. While they can be made larger, signs over 48 inches often require traditional retainers for structural safety in high winds.
6. Is it difficult to change the lights if an LED fails?
No, it is actually quite simple. Most trimless letters are designed with removable faces or backs. A technician can quickly remove a few hidden screws, swap out the LED module, and reattach the face in a matter of minutes, ensuring your brand stays lit with minimal downtime.
